news 2026/6/24 12:34:07

微信网页版复活指南:wechat-need-web让电脑端聊天不再受限

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
微信网页版复活指南:wechat-need-web让电脑端聊天不再受限

微信网页版复活指南:wechat-need-web让电脑端聊天不再受限

【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web

还在为微信网页版无法正常使用而烦恼吗?当你在电脑前工作时,突然需要回复微信消息,却发现网页版提示"请在手机端登录",这种中断工作流程的体验确实令人沮丧。今天介绍的开源项目wechat-need-web,正是为解决这一痛点而生的浏览器扩展方案。

真实场景:为什么我们需要微信网页版?

想象一下这样的工作场景:你在电脑前专注处理文档,手机放在一旁充电。突然需要与同事沟通工作细节,或者查看微信群里的重要通知。此时如果能够直接在浏览器中使用微信,无疑是最便捷的选择。

然而,微信官方近年来对网页版实施了严格的访问限制,主要原因包括:

  • 安全策略升级:加强了对异常登录行为的检测机制
  • 生态闭环需求:推动用户使用桌面客户端和移动端应用
  • 技术门槛提升:增加了复杂的验证流程和头部信息校验

解决方案:wechat-need-web如何实现突破?

wechat-need-web是一个基于浏览器扩展技术的开源项目,它通过巧妙的方式绕过了微信的访问限制。该扩展只对微信相关域名生效,精确控制规则应用范围,确保不会影响其他网站的正常使用。

从上图可以看到,扩展成功实现了微信网页版的完整功能界面。左侧是联系人列表和搜索功能,右侧是聊天窗口,底部是消息输入区域。整个界面布局清晰,功能模块完整,为用户提供了流畅的聊天体验。

核心技术:三大功能亮点解析

智能请求管理

扩展通过浏览器提供的declarativeNetRequest API,在请求发送到微信服务器之前,动态添加必要的头部信息和查询参数。这种设计既保证了功能的实现,又避免了性能损耗。

动态头部注入

项目使用TypeScript编写的规则生成器,为每个请求动态设置微信所需的特定头部信息。这种技术方案确保了扩展的稳定性和兼容性。

跨平台支持

针对不同浏览器平台的特性,wechat-need-web提供了差异化的配置方案。无论是Chrome、Edge还是Firefox用户,都能获得良好的使用体验。

实操指南:四步完成扩展部署

第一步:环境准备

确保你的浏览器版本符合要求:

  • Chrome浏览器:88及以上版本
  • Edge浏览器:88及以上版本
  • Firefox浏览器:113及以上版本

第二步:获取项目源码

git clone https://gitcode.com/gh_mirrors/we/wechat-need-web cd wechat-need-web

第三步:构建扩展

npm install npm run build

构建完成后,项目根目录会生成dist文件夹,其中包含浏览器可识别的扩展文件。

第四步:浏览器加载

  1. 打开浏览器扩展管理页面
  2. 启用"开发者模式"选项
  3. 点击"加载已解压的扩展程序"
  4. 选择构建生成的dist目录

使用提示:注意事项与最佳实践

账号安全考虑

由于扩展修改了网络请求行为,可能会触发腾讯的安全检测机制。建议:

  • 避免在重要工作账号上长期使用
  • 定期关注项目更新动态
  • 如收到安全警告,及时暂停使用

功能稳定性

微信官方可能随时调整访问机制,扩展效果可能会受到影响。建议用户:

  • 及时更新到最新版本
  • 了解基本工作原理,便于自行排查问题

技术价值:开源项目的意义所在

wechat-need-web不仅解决了用户的具体需求,更展示了现代浏览器扩展开发的最佳实践。通过TypeScript的强类型支持和模块化设计,项目确保了代码的可维护性和扩展性。

该项目的技术亮点包括:

  • 清晰的架构设计:主程序、规则生成器、配置管理模块分工明确
  • 良好的兼容性:支持主流浏览器平台
  • 持续的技术演进:紧跟浏览器技术发展

总结展望

wechat-need-web项目为技术爱好者提供了一个很好的学习案例。它展示了如何通过浏览器扩展技术解决实际问题,同时也为处理类似网页访问限制问题提供了技术思路和实现框架。

记住,技术创新的目的始终是为了更好地服务于用户需求。当官方渠道无法满足特定使用场景时,开源社区往往能够提供创新的解决方案。wechat-need-web就是这样一个典型的例子,它证明了技术的力量可以突破各种限制,为用户创造更便捷的体验。

【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/11 18:20:35

Windows远程桌面限制破解:RDP Wrapper高效多用户方案全解析

Windows远程桌面限制破解:RDP Wrapper高效多用户方案全解析 【免费下载链接】rdpwrap RDP Wrapper Library 项目地址: https://gitcode.com/gh_mirrors/rd/rdpwrap 你是否曾经遇到过这样的场景:当家人需要使用电脑时,你不得不中断自己…

作者头像 李华
网站建设 2026/6/3 9:49:32

Windows远程桌面破解秘籍:RDP Wrapper实现多人并发访问

Windows远程桌面破解秘籍:RDP Wrapper实现多人并发访问 【免费下载链接】rdpwrap RDP Wrapper Library 项目地址: https://gitcode.com/gh_mirrors/rd/rdpwrap 还在为Windows远程桌面的单用户限制而烦恼吗?想要实现多人同时远程访问却不想升级昂贵…

作者头像 李华
网站建设 2026/6/19 3:26:22

OneMore插件:160+功能如何让你的OneNote生产力飙升300%?

OneMore插件:160功能如何让你的OneNote生产力飙升300%? 【免费下载链接】OneMore A OneNote add-in with simple, yet powerful and useful features 项目地址: https://gitcode.com/gh_mirrors/on/OneMore 还在为OneNote的功能限制而烦恼吗&…

作者头像 李华
网站建设 2026/5/28 15:58:04

STM32嵌入式开发终极指南:从零到精通的完整解决方案

STM32嵌入式开发终极指南:从零到精通的完整解决方案 【免费下载链接】stm32 STM32 stuff 项目地址: https://gitcode.com/gh_mirrors/st/stm32 还在为STM32嵌入式开发找不到合适的学习资源而烦恼吗?今天我要向大家推荐一个嵌入式开发的"宝藏…

作者头像 李华
网站建设 2026/6/16 11:59:15

OneMore插件:从功能限制到工作流优化的技术解决方案

OneMore插件:从功能限制到工作流优化的技术解决方案 【免费下载链接】OneMore A OneNote add-in with simple, yet powerful and useful features 项目地址: https://gitcode.com/gh_mirrors/on/OneMore 从效率瓶颈到工作流重构 在传统的OneNote使用场景中&…

作者头像 李华
网站建设 2026/6/16 16:14:44

快速理解 screen+ rc 配置文件的结构与作用

构建你的终端操作系统:深入理解.screenrc配置与screen多会话管理你有没有遇到过这样的场景?深夜调试一个关键服务,日志在滚动、监控在跑、编译正在进行。突然网络断了——再连上去时,所有进程都已终止,一切从头开始。或…

作者头像 李华